Why this happens

The injector assembly creates suction to draw brine from the salt tank into the resin tank during regeneration. Over time, mineral deposits, salt residue, or wear can reduce its ability to pull brine effectively. Checking the injector for clogging or damage confirms if it’s the source of your regeneration issues. If it’s not working right, the brine flow won’t be correct.

How this valve injector fixes it

This part replaces the worn or clogged injector assembly that draws brine during regeneration. It works by creating a controlled vacuum that pulls the right amount of brine solution into the resin tank. This precise control helps the resin beads get fully cleaned, restoring your system’s ability to soften water consistently and efficiently. In other words, it does the job of feeding brine exactly when and how much your softener needs.
